What is a Business Plan?

  • Definition: Business plan defines goals, finances, team, future planning. Outlines market research, competitor analysis, financials, overview of business, marketing strategy.

  • Format: Includes executive summary, company overview, market analysis, organization/management, financial projections, marketing strategies, operational plans.

  • Benefits: Helps focus on goals, strategize efforts to achieve them. Helps team visualize vision.

Sections in a business plan:

  • Executive summary, business description, market analysis, competitive analysis, sales/marketing plan, management plan, operating plan, financial plan.
  • Describes operations, spurs questions and research. State clearly what you want early on, discuss industry outlook, compare to competitors, explain concepts, and daily operations.
